Gaming cushion

If you only get one thing for the gamer in your life, let it be this!

It’s hugely helpful in supporting the arms, which then takes pressure off the spine and neck that are easily damaged with bad posture.

Many neurodivergent people do not sit naturally in the upright position and the slouching can cause damage – having this cushion will help with posture.

Plus, it feels super soft on the top surface and has a simple design so very neurodivergent-friendly 🕹️
